Representative Michael McCaul (R)

Current Office: Representative
District: TX-10
First Elected: 11/02/2004
Next Election: 2012
Party: Republican

General

Gender: Male
Family: Wife: Linda; 5 Children: Caroline, Jewell, Lauren, Michael, Avery
Birth date: 01/14/1962
Birthplace: Dallas, TX
Home City: Austin TX
Religion:

Profession

Senior Advisor, Homeland Security, Office of the Texas Governor Former Deputy Attorney General, State of Texas Former Chief, Terrorism and National Security Section, Criminal Division, Western Judicial District of Texas, United States Attorney's Office Former Trial Attorney, Public Integrity Section, Criminal Division, United States Justice Department

Education

JD, Saint Mary's University School of Law, 1987 BS, Business and History, Trinity University, 1984
